Phase Transformers Market by Type (Direct, Indirect, Asymmetrical, Symmetrical) by Application (Power Lines, Grid Stability and Others) and by Region - Global Trends and Forecast to 2027
A phase transformer is a specialized type of transformer, typically used to control the flow of active power on three-phase electric transmission networks. The functions of the phase transformer are to defend transmission lines, make power grids more dependable as well as decrease losses in transmission. A phase transformer is an essential component that is used to enhance the efficiency of the AC network. When the transmitted energy increases then it will push the network to the edge, enhancing the threat of network insecurity. It does so by regulating the voltage phase angle difference between two nodes of the system. The principle relies on a phase-shifted voltage source injection into the line by a series connected transformer, which is fed by a shunt transformer. The configuration of the shunt and series transformer unit induces the phase shift.
